Transaction 524ef045e67fa494dab158e322437551d7acdc16b41032f2b6a7ea280f8cf372

2 Input
2 Outputs
  • 524ef045e67fa494dab158e322437551d7acdc16b41032f2b6a7ea280f8cf372:0
  • value  907436
    address  16HT73Dom6bsjbAFAKXT7waJTYFjQTrBe4
  • 524ef045e67fa494dab158e322437551d7acdc16b41032f2b6a7ea280f8cf372:1
  • value  906293
    address  3B6VugHZYFZHm5Y333CVwnu3JbqtScHCd7